Interventions
- ranibizumab — DRUGLucentis® (ranibizumab) 0.3mg (0.05ml volume) intravitreal injection. Eligible patients will be initially received three session of monthly injection of Lucentis® (week 0, 4, 8). After 4 weeks from third injection, a session of verteporfin PDT (week 12) and fourth injection of Lucentis® (week 16) will be added at intervals of 4 weeks. Two more combined treatment with verteporfin PDT and Lucentis® injection 4 weeks apart can be added at the treating physician's discretion in 3-month intervals (week 28, week 40).
Study Details
The purpose of this study is to evaluate changes in preferential hyperacuity perimeter (PHP) and fundus autofluorescence (FAF) in patients with neovascular age-related macular degeneration receiving combination of ranibizumab (LucentisTM) and verteporfin (Visudyne®) therapy
